Epoxy Paints

Epoxy paints are a popular choice for Inconel 3D printed parts. They offer great adhesion to metal surfaces, which is crucial when dealing with Inconel. Epoxies are known for their high chemical resistance, which means they can protect the Inconel from various corrosive substances. Whether it's exposure to chemicals in an industrial setting or just general environmental corrosion, epoxy paints can form a tough barrier.

One of the advantages of epoxy paints is their durability. They can withstand mechanical stress, such as abrasion and impact. This is important because Inconel 3D printed parts are often used in applications where they might be subject to some rough handling. For example, in aerospace or automotive industries, parts need to be able to hold up under normal operating conditions.

Another plus is that epoxy paints come in a variety of colors. So, if you want to match the color of your Inconel parts to a specific design or brand, you have plenty of options. You can find epoxy paints that are specifically formulated for high - temperature applications as well. This is great for Inconel parts that are going to be exposed to heat, as the paint won't break down easily.

Ceramic Paints

Ceramic paints are another option to consider. These paints are known for their outstanding heat resistance. Inconel already has good high - temperature properties, but ceramic paints can take it a step further. They can help reduce heat transfer to the surrounding environment and also protect the Inconel from thermal shock.

Ceramic paints form a hard, ceramic - like coating on the surface of the Inconel part. This coating is very smooth, which can reduce friction in some applications. For instance, in a turbine engine where Inconel parts are used, the smooth surface provided by ceramic paint can improve the efficiency of the engine.

However, ceramic paints can be a bit more challenging to apply compared to epoxy paints. They usually require a specific application process and curing conditions. But if you're looking for the ultimate in heat protection for your Inconel 3D printed parts, ceramic paints are definitely worth considering.

Polyurethane Paints

Polyurethane paints are well - known for their flexibility and UV resistance. If your Inconel parts are going to be exposed to sunlight or outdoor conditions, polyurethane paints can be a great choice. They can prevent the parts from fading and also protect them from the damaging effects of UV rays.

The flexibility of polyurethane paints is also an advantage. Inconel parts may experience some expansion and contraction due to temperature changes. Polyurethane paints can accommodate these movements without cracking or peeling. This ensures that the protective coating remains intact over time.

In addition, polyurethane paints offer good chemical resistance. They can resist a wide range of chemicals, making them suitable for use in different industrial environments. Whether it's in a chemical processing plant or a marine application, polyurethane - painted Inconel parts can hold up well.

Factors to Consider When Choosing Paint

When choosing a paint for your Inconel 3D printed parts, there are several factors to keep in mind.

Surface Preparation

Proper surface preparation is crucial for any paint to adhere well. For Inconel, the surface should be clean and free of any contaminants such as oil, grease, or dust. You may need to use a degreaser and then sand the surface lightly to create a rough texture for better paint adhesion.

Application Method

The application method can also affect the choice of paint. Some paints are better suited for spray application, while others can be brushed or rolled on. Consider the size and shape of your Inconel parts when deciding on the application method. For complex 3D printed shapes, spray application might be more effective to ensure even coverage.

Environmental Conditions

Think about the environment where the Inconel parts will be used. If it's a high - temperature environment, heat - resistant paints like ceramic or high - temperature epoxy are necessary. For outdoor use, UV - resistant paints such as polyurethane are a good option. And if the parts will be exposed to chemicals, choose a paint with high chemical resistance.

Cost

Cost is always a factor. Epoxy paints are generally more affordable compared to ceramic paints. However, you need to balance the cost with the performance requirements of your application. Sometimes, spending a bit more on a high - performance paint can save you money in the long run by reducing maintenance and replacement costs.
